G602 LWP is a 1990 Fiat Ducato in White with a 2,500cc diesel engine. This vehicle has been through 20 MOT tests with a personal pass rate of 55%.
Across all 1990 Fiat Ducato models, the average MOT pass rate is 65.5% with a typical mileage of 76,860 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Fiat Ducato fails its MOT is windscreen wiper does not clear the windscreen effectively, accounting for 34,174 recorded failures. If you're considering buying G602 LWP, it's worth having these areas checked by a mechanic before committing.
The Fiat Ducato typically stays on UK roads for around 38 years. At 36 years old, this Fiat Ducato is approaching the upper end of the typical lifespan for this model.
